Question Hood Springs for 50 Ford F1

I have seen a number of posts on this forum about spring replacement on the 48-50 Ford F1 and folks seem to be able to obtain new springs. Where do you get them? I've about searched out the internet and havne't found a single or set of springs for the hood hinges....all I can find is a spring for the opening latch and I'm not sure that fits the 48-50..
